Morle at a glance

Morle is a village of 458 people in 127 households (Census 2011) in Dodamarg taluka, Sindhudurg district, Maharashtra, the 36th-largest of 60 villages in Dodamarg taluka. Literacy is 78%, 2 points above the taluka average of 75% and the sex ratio is 1,140 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 416549, served by Konalkatta Colony post office; the LGD village code is 566953. The village votes in Chandgad assembly constituency, represented by MLA Shivaji Shattupa Patil. The population is estimated at 540 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
